The 90s tucked-in trend wasn't just for the guys – the ladies were serving looks that were all that and a bag of chips. From TLC's baggy style to Janet Jackson's sleek outfits, tucking in was an art form that defined an era.

Key elements of the women's tucked-in trend:
Crop Tops: Short tees tucked into high-waisted jeans or skirts were a staple. Think Aaliyah's iconic Tommy Hilfiger look.
Oversized Button-Ups: Baggy shirts tucked into mom jeans, often with only the front tucked in for that casual-cool vibe.
Body Suits: The ultimate in tucked-in technology, bodysuits were everywhere, from casual wear to red carpets.
Matching Sets: Coordinated top and bottom sets, often in bold prints, with the top neatly tucked in.
How to rock the tucked-in look, 90s R&B diva style:
High-waisted everything. Whether it's jeans, skirts, or shorts, the higher the waist, the better the tuck.
Mix fitted and loose. A tight bodysuit with baggy jeans? That's peak 90s fashion right there.
Don't forget the midriff. Even with tucked-in looks, showing a bit of stomach was all the rage.
Accessorize, accessorize, accessorize. From door-knocker earrings to chunky belts, accessories made the outfit.
Thrifting tips for the perfect 90s women's tuck:
Look for authentic 90s brands. Guess, Bebe, and Baby Phat were huge.
High-waisted jeans are gold. The more mom-jean-esque, the better.
Keep an eye out for bodysuits. They're the easiest way to achieve that sleek tucked-in look.
Don't shy away from bold patterns and colors. The 90s were all about making a statement.
Style icons to channel:
Left Eye from TLC: Master of the baggy, tucked-in look. Pair oversized shirts with equally roomy pants.
Janet Jackson: Queen of the bodysuit. Look for high-cut, form-fitting pieces to tuck into literally everything.
Destiny's Child-era Beyoncé: Coordinated sets were her thing. Seek out matching top-and-bottom combos.
Mary J. Blige: The queen of hip-hop soul rocked everything from tucked-in tees to sleek bodysuits.
